Skip to main content

Contoh Soal PAS Basis Data SMK Kelas 12 Tahun 2023 disertai Jawaban

Contoh Soal PAS Basis Data SMK Kelas 12 Tahun 2023 disertai Jawaban
PAS Basis Data Kelas 12 Semester 1 SMK. Dibagikan dalam rangka melengkap contoh soal di jurusan RPL untuk kelas 12 Sekolah Menengah Kejuruan. Selanjutnya kami memberikan naskah dalam bentuk  soal try out online dan berkas pdf yang semuanya sudah tersedia kunci jawaban di masing - masing butirnya. 

Dengan jumlah keseluruhan soal PAS Basis Data SMK Kelas 12 adalah 20 butir  pilian ganda untuk try out online dan 100 butir soal untuk berkas pdf yang kami sediakan di bawah, 

Materi dan kisi - kisi basis data dari kompetensi (RPL) Kelas 12 bisa kamu tanyakan lebih jelasnya langsung lewat guru pengajar yang mana menggunakan kurikulum 2013 dalam pembelajarannya.

Contoh Soal PAS Basis Data SMK Kelas 12 Tahun 2023 disertai Jawaban

Contoh Soal PAS Basis Data Kelas 12

Naskah dari contoh latihan "Soal PAS Basis Data kelas 12 SMK semester 1" diambil dari arsip ujian daring SMK tahun sebelumnya. Bagi siswa yang ingin mempelajarinya diharap juga mencocokkannya dengan materi yang ada. 
Baca Juga : KUMPULAN Soal RPL Kelas 12 jenjang SMK Semester 1 dan 2 (Semua Mapel)
File PDF berada setelah try out online berikut ini. Selamat mengerjakan..

1. Tamplikanlah seluruh field yang berada didalam tabel benda
A. select benda;
B. select * from benda; 
C. select * benda;
D. select * benda;
Jawaban : B

2. Cara menghapus table benda
A. drop table * benda; 
B. drop table benda;
C. drop table benda; 
D. drop table_benda;
Jawaban : A

3. Buat lah user baru pada table karyawan dengan user = sofyan dan password = sosa
A. SQL create user sofyan identified by sosa; 
B. SQL> create user sofyan by sosa;
C. SQL> create user sofyan identified by sosa;
D. SQL> create user sofyan identified by sosa;
Jawaban : C

4. Tampilkan last name dengan huruf capital dimana last name nya di awali dengan huruf ‘A’
A. SQL> select upper(last_name),salary from employees where last_name 'A%';
B. SQL> select upper(last_name),salary from employees where last_name like 'A%'; C. SQL> select upper(last_name),salary from employees where last_name like 'A';
D. SQL> select upper(last_name),salary from employees where last_name like 'A%;
Jawaban : B

5. Buatlah kolom NIP pada table karyawan sebagai index
A. SQL> create index karyawan nip idx on karyawan(nip); 
B. SQL> create index karyawan_nip_idx on karyawan(nip)
C. SQL> create index karyawan_nip_idx on karyawan(nip); 
D. SQL> create index karyawan_nip_idx karyawan(nip);
Jawaban : C

6. Hapus hak akses delete dari user sosa
A. Revoke delete on karyawan from sosa; 
B. Revoke delete on karyawan sosa;
C. Revoke delete karyawan from sosa;
D. Revoke delete on karyawan from sosa
Jawaban : A

7. Buatlah kolom NIP sebagai primary key pada table karyawan
A. SQL> alter table karyawan add constraint pk_nip primary key nip; 
B. SQL> alter table karyawan add constraint pk_nip primary key (nip)
C. SQL> alter table karyawan add constraint pk_nip primary key (nip); 
D. SQL> alter table karyawan add constraint pk nip primary key (nip);
Jawaban : C

8. Buat lah benda dengan field kode_benda char(6),nama benda varchar2(25),satuan_benda varchar2(20) dan stok_benda number(4) primary key adalah kode benda :

A. create table benda( 
kode_benda char(6), 
nama_benda varchar2(25), 
satuan_benda varchar2(20), 
stock_benda number(4),
constraint pk_benda primary key(kode_benda)
);

B. create table benda( 
kode_benda char(6) 
nama_benda varchar2(25) 
satuan_benda varchar2(20) 
stock_benda number(4)
constraint pk_benda primary key(kode_benda)
);

C. create table benda( 
kode_benda char(6), 
nama_benda varchar2(25),
constraint pk_benda primary key(kode_benda)
); 

D. create table benda(
kode_benda char(6),
nama_benda varchar2(25), 
satuan_benda varchar2(20), 
stock_benda number(4),
constraint pk_benda primary key(kode_benda)
);
Jawaban : A

9. Buatlah kolom email pada table pegawai sebagai kolom unique
A. SQL> alter table karyawan add constraint uq_email unique (email); 
B. SQL> alter table karyawan add constraint uq_email unique (email)
C. SQL> alter table karyawan on constraint uq_email unique (email);
D. SQL> alter table karyawan on constraint uq_email unique (email);
Jawaban : A

10.Isikan lah sebuah recordke dalam tabel benda seperti tampilan berikut : KODE_benda NAMA_benda SATUAN_benda STOK_benda KPR-1 KULKAS BUAH 20
A. insert into benda values('KPR-01','KULKAS','BUAH','20'); 
B. insert into_benda values('KPR-01','KULKAS','BUAH','20');
C. insert benda_values('KPR-01','KULKAS','BUAH','20'); 
D. insert into benda values(KPR-01,KULKAS,BUAH,20);
Jawaban : A

11.Perangkat Lunak (Software) yang digunakan untuk mengelola kumpulan atau koleksi data, dimana data tersebut diorganisasikan atau disusun ke dalam suatu model data disebut…
A. Field
B. Record
C. DBMS 
D. Tabel
Jawaban : C

12.Microsoft Access,Database Oracle adalah salah satu program aplikasi DBMS apa singkatan dari DBMS tersebut…
A. Database Multiple System
B. Database Management System
C. Data Management System
D. Database Management Supply
Jawaban : B

13.Data yang menggambarkan kumpulan karakteristik suatu entitas….
A. Field 
B. Record
C. DBMS 
D. Database
Jawaban : B

14.Perintah yang digunakan untuk memanipulasi data adalah…
A. Report 
B. Query
C. Form 
D. Tabel
Jawaban : B

15.Karakteristik dari suatu Entity yang menyediakan penjelasan detail tentang entity disebut
A. Data Field
B. Data Record
C. Attribut
D. Entity
Jawaban : C

16.Ciri dari Primary Key adalah ....
A. Bersifat unik
B. Bersifat umum
C. Memiliki kesamaan data dengan
D. Mudah dihapal
Jawaban : A

17.Sql dipublikasikan oleh :
A. E.F Codd 
C. R.F Boyce
B. D. Chamberlin 
D. Euler
Jawaban : C

18.Berikut ini adalah sasaran dari SQL, kecuali : 
A. Menciptakan basis data dan struktur relasi 
B. Harus portable
C. Membuat pemrograman terstruktur dengan grafis
D. Mengelompokan data yang komplek
Jawaban : B

19.Salah satu contoh data manipulation language
A. ALTER 
B. TABLE 
C. CHAT 
D. SELECT
Jawaban : D

20.Pengembangan MySQL dengan tool database UNIREG dibuat oleh…
A. E.F Codd 
B. Michael Widenius 
C. R.F Boyce
D. David
Jawaban : A

100 PAS Basis Data Kelas 12 SMK + Jawaban pdf : DOWNLOAD


Diharapkan Contoh Soal PAS Basis Data SMK Kelas 12 Tahun 2023 disertai Jawaban bermanfaat untuk tenaga didik dan siswa sekalian.

Ki Hajar Dewantara : “Ing Ngarsa Sung Tuladha Ing Madya Mangun Karsa Tut Wuri Handayani”,- Di depan memberi contoh, di tengah memberi semangat dan di belakang memberikan kekuatan.